Python SDK

Advisor Software Development Kit for python.

Contents


Importing

To install this package, use the following command:`

pip install stormgeo.advisor-core

Make sure you're using python 3.8 or higher.

Routes

First you need to import the SDK on your application and instancy the AdvisorCore class setting up your access token and needed configurations:

from advisor_core import *

advisor = AdvisorCore("<your_token>", retries=5, delay=5)

Examples

Get data from different routes with theses examples

Chart

payload = WeatherPayload(
  locale_id=1234,
  variables=["temperature", "precipitation"]
)

# requesting daily forecast chart image
response = advisor.chart.get_forecast_daily(payload)

# requesting hourly forecast chart image
response = advisor.chart.get_forecast_hourly(payload)

# requesting daily observed chart image
response = advisor.chart.get_observed_daily(payload)

# requesting hourly observed chart image
response = advisor.chart.get_observed_hourly(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  with open("response.png", "wb") as f:
    f.write(response["data"])

Climatology

payload = ClimatologyPayload(
  locale_id=1234,
  variables=["temperature", "precipitation"]
)

# requesting daily climatology data
response = advisor.climatology.get_daily(payload)

# requesting monthly climatology data
response = advisor.climatology.get_monthly(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

Current Weather

payload = CurrentWeatherPayload(
  locale_id=1234
)

response = advisor.current_weather.get(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

Forecast

payload = WeatherPayload(
  locale_id=1234,
  variables=["temperature", "precipitation"]
)

# requesting daily forecast data
response = advisor.forecast.get_daily(payload)

# requesting hourly forecast data
response = advisor.forecast.get_hourly(payload)

# requesting period forecast data
response = advisor.forecast.get_period(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

Monitoring

response = advisor.monitoring.get_alerts()

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

Observed

payload = WeatherPayload(
  locale_id=1234,
)

payload_for_station = StationPayload(
  station_id="ABC123abc321CBA"
)

payload_for_radius = RadiusPayload(
  locale_id=1234,
  radius=1000
)

payload_for_geometry = GeometryPayload(
  geometry="{\"type\": \"MultiPoint\", \"coordinates\": [[-41.88, -22.74]]}",
  radius=10000
)

# requesting daily observed data
response = advisor.observed.get_daily(payload)

# requesting hourly observed data
response = advisor.observed.get_hourly(payload)

# requesting period observed data
response = advisor.observed.get_period(payload)

# requesting station observed data
response = advisor.observed.get_station_data(payload_for_station)

# requesting fire-focus observed data
response = advisor.observed.get_fire_focus(payload_for_radius)

# requesting lightning observed data
response = advisor.observed.get_lightning(payload_for_radius)

# requesting fire-focus observed data by geometry
response = advisor.observed.get_fire_focus_by_geometry(payload_for_geometry)

# requesting lightning observed data by geometry
response = advisor.observed.get_lightning_by_geometry(payload_for_geometry)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

Stations

payload = StationsLastDataPayload(
  station_ids=["ABC123abc321CBA", "XYZ789xyz987ZYX"], # optional
  variables=["temperature", "humidity"] # optional
)

# requesting last observed data for multiple stations
response = advisor.stations.get_last_data(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

Storage

payload = StorageListPayload(
  page=1,
  page_size=10,
  file_types=["pdf", "csv"]
)

payload_for_download = StorageDownloadPayload(
  file_name="Example.pdf",
  access_key="a1b2c3d4-0010"
)

# requesting the files list
response = advisor.storage.list_files(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

# downloading a file from the list
response = advisor.storage.download_file(payload_for_download)

if response['error']:
    print('Error trying to get data')
    print(response['error'])
else:
    with open(payload_for_download.file_name, "wb") as f:
        f.write(response["data"])

# downloading a file by stream
response = advisor.storage.download_file_by_stream(payload_for_download)

if response['error']:
    print('Error trying to get data')
    print(response['error'])
else:
    with open(payload_for_download.file_name, "wb") as f:
        for chunk in response['data']:
            if chunk:
                f.write(chunk)

Plan Information

# requesting plan information
plan_info_payload = PlanInfoPayload(
    timezone=-3
)

plan_info_response = advisor.plan.get_info(plan_info_payload)

if plan_info_response['error']:
    print('Error trying to get plan information!')
    print(plan_info_response['error'])
else:
    print(plan_info_response['data'])

# requesting locale details
plan_locale_payload = PlanLocalePayload(
    locale_id=1234,
    # You can also set Latitude/Longitude or StationId instead of LocaleId
)

plan_locale_response = advisor.plan.get_locale(plan_locale_payload)

if plan_locale_response['error']:
    print('Error trying to get plan locale!')
    print(plan_locale_response['error'])
else:
    print(plan_locale_response['data'])

# requesting access history
request_details_payload = RequestDetailsPayload(
    page=1,
    page_size=10
)

request_details_response = advisor.plan.get_request_details(request_details_payload)

if request_details_response['error']:
    print('Error trying to get request details!')
    print(request_details_response['error'])
else:
    print(request_details_response['data'])

Static Map

payload = StaticMapPayload(
    type="periods",
    category="observed",
    variable="temperature",
    aggregation="max",
    start_date="2025-07-01 00:00:00",
    end_date="2025-07-05 23:59:59",
    dpi=50,
    title=True,
    titlevariable="Static Map",
)

response = advisor.static_map.get_static_map(payload)

if response['error']:
    print('Error trying to get data!')
    print(response['error'])
else:
    with open("response.png", "wb") as f:
        f.write(response["data"])

Schema/Parameter

# Arbitrary example on how to define a schema
payload_schema_definition = {
  "identifier": "arbitraryIdentifier",
  "arbitraryField1": {
      "type": "boolean",
      "required": True,
      "length": 125,
  },
  "arbitraryField2": {
      "type": "number",
      "required": True,
  },
  "arbitraryField3": {
      "type": "string",
      "required": False,
  }
}

# Arbitrary example on how to upload data to parameters from schema 
payload_schema_parameters = {
  "identifier": "arbitraryIdentifier",
  "arbitraryField1": True,
  "arbitraryField2": 15
}

# requesting all schemas from token
response = advisor.schema.get_definition()

# requesting to upload a new schema
response = advisor.schema.post_definition(payload_schema_definition)

# requesting to upload data to parameters from schema
response = advisor.schema.post_parameters(payload_schema_parameters)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  print(response['data'])

Tms (Tiles Map Server)

payload = TmsPayload(
  istep="2024-12-25 10:00:00",
  fstep="2024-12-25 12:00:00",
  server="a",
  mode="forecast",
  variable="precipitation",
  aggregation="sum",
  x=2,
  y=3,
  z=4
)

response = advisor.tms.get(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  with open("response.png", "wb") as f:
    f.write(response["data"])

Pmtiles

payload = PmtilesPayload(
  mode="forecast",
  model="ct2w15_as",
  variable="precipitation",
  aggregation="sum",
  istep="2026-03-02 00:00:00",
  fstep="2026-03-02 01:00:00",
  max_zoom=4,
)

response = advisor.pmtiles.get(payload)

if response['error']:
  print('Error trying to get data!')
  print(response['error'])
else:
  with open("response.pmtiles", "wb") as f:
    f.write(response["data"])

Headers Configuration

You can also set headers to translate the error descriptions or to receive the response in a different format type. This functionality is only available for some routes, consult the API documentation to find out which routes have this functionality.

Available languages:

  • en-US (default)
  • pt-BR
  • es-ES

Available response types:

  • application/json (default)
  • application/xml
  • text/csv

Example:

advisor = AdvisorCore("invalid-token")

advisor.setHeaderAccept("application/xml")
advisor.setHeaderAcceptLanguage("es-ES")

response = advisor.plan.get_info()

print(response["error"])

// <response>
//   <error>
//     <type>UNAUTHORIZED_ACCESS</type>
//     <message>UNAUTHORIZED_REQUEST</message>
//     <description>La solicitud no está autorizada.</description>
//   </error>
// </response>

Response Format

All the methods will return the same pattern:

{
  "data": Any | None,
  "error": Any | None,
}

Payload Types

WeatherPayload

  • locale_id: int
  • station_id: str
  • latitude: float
  • longitude: float
  • timezone: int
  • variables: List[str]
  • start_date: str
  • end_date: str

StationPayload

  • station_id: str
  • layer: str
  • timezone: int
  • variables: List[str]
  • start_date: str
  • end_date: str

StationsLastDataPayload

  • station_ids: List[str]
  • variables: List[str]

ClimatologyPayload

  • locale_id: int
  • station_id: str
  • latitude: float
  • longitude: float
  • variables: List[str]

CurrentWeatherPayload

  • locale_id: int
  • station_id: str
  • latitude: float
  • longitude: float
  • timezone: int
  • variables: List[str]

RadiusPayload

  • locale_id: int
  • station_id: str
  • latitude: float
  • longitude: float
  • start_date: str
  • end_date: str
  • radius: int

GeometryPayload

  • start_date: str
  • end_date: str
  • radius: int
  • geometry: str

TmsPayload

  • server: str
  • mode: str
  • variable: str
  • aggregation: str
  • x: int
  • y: int
  • z: int
  • istep: str
  • fstep: str
  • timezone: int

PmtilesPayload

  • mode: str
  • model: str
  • variable: str
  • aggregation: str
  • istep: str
  • fstep: str
  • timezone: int
  • max_zoom: int

PlanInfoPayload

  • timezone: int

PlanLocalePayload

  • locale_id: int
  • station_id: str
  • latitude: str
  • longitude: str

RequestDetailsPayload

  • page: int
  • page_size: int
  • path: str
  • status: int
  • start_date: str
  • end_date: str

StorageListPayload

  • page: int
  • page_size: int
  • start_date: str
  • end_date: str
  • file_name: str
  • file_extension: str
  • file_types: List[str]

StorageDownloadPayload

  • file_name: str
  • access_key: str

StaticMapPayload

  • start_date: str
  • end_date: str
  • aggregation: str
  • model: str
  • lonmin: float
  • latmin: float
  • lonmax: float
  • latmax: float
  • dpi: int
  • title: bool
  • titlevariable: str
  • hours: int
  • type: str
  • category: str
  • variable: str
